Cute houseboat, amazing location!!! Extremely walkable to restaurants and shops
Multilevel 1 bedroom houseboat in desirable Sausalito. Experience tranquility while working from home in the nice sized kitchen with fabulous views of water and hills. (High speed wi-if included). Or kick your shoes off and unwind while taking in the views after a long day at work! Houseboat is in a safe marina with quiet neighbors. Restaurants, shops and bars within a 10 minute walk. Ferry and bus to the city also a 10 minute walk. Next door to the marina is the newly renovated Dunphy Park with bocce ball court, sand volleyball court and gazebo. Enjoy the outdoors on the rooftop deck or the houseboats front bench. Guests are welcome to use the two kayaks, which can be launched from the houseboats pier. Many amazing hiking trails nearby in the Headlands or at Tennessee Valley. Ocean beaches are a 20 minute drive. Free street parking near by or guests can obtain a parking permit for lot at marina for $35/month.

I spent a month on the houseboat called “Salty Dog”. I had my 20 lb puppy, Tilly with me and a friend who is a professional pet sitter came and joined us a few times. Two things really impressed me. 1., the boat was superbly equipped as if ready for a long range voyage and 2. The neighbors were all Salties - creative, fun, and helpful. Proximity to everything from a grocery store , laundry and to a pub and a bunch of great local restaurants all within walking distance was great. Parking was easy and, despite the 3 hours max sign, parked there every night for a month and never got a ticket. The vibe was brilliant and the humor and funny decorations were very sweet. Kimberly and her husband were super responsive when we had a question. All in all a 5 star experience with a three star price!
Property was well maintained. Kimberly and Ryan made sure I knew how things worked on the houseboat that were different from a typical house on land. Great view of the Sausalito hills and harbors. Great Blue Herons and Egrets visited daily! Walking distance to shops, hardware, restaurants, Grocery, and library. Comfey bed and all appliances. Compact yet felt spacious with all of the windows and sunshine pouring in. Top notch communication and troubleshooting from the host. Five Stars
